Output ddcf6fb930c1578d973409d1df39fc9491273dda2830e349d42e34025b3aab65:191

value
423436
script pubkey
OP_0 OP_PUSHBYTES_20 d82ecf0ac0799b24ac091171b0257541158243aa
address
bc1qmqhv7zkq0xdjftqfz9cmqft4gy2cysa2tleh8c
transaction
ddcf6fb930c1578d973409d1df39fc9491273dda2830e349d42e34025b3aab65